1992 Fiat Panda vs. 1948 Peugeot 202
To start off, 1992 Fiat Panda is newer by 44 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1948 Peugeot 202.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1948 Peugeot 202 would be higher. At 1,133 cc (4 cylinders), 1948 Peugeot 202 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1992 Fiat Panda (38 HP @ 5500 RPM) has 8 more horse power than 1948 Peugeot 202. (30 HP @ 4000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1992 Fiat Panda should accelerate faster than 1948 Peugeot 202.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1948 Peugeot 202 weights approximately 90 kg more than 1992 Fiat Panda.
Because 1948 Peugeot 202 is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 1948 Peugeot 202.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1992 Fiat Panda,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
Compare all specifications:
1992 Fiat Panda | 1948 Peugeot 202 | |
Make | Fiat | Peugeot |
Model | Panda | 202 |
Year Released | 1992 | 1948 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 899 cc | 1133 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Horse Power | 38 HP | 30 HP |
Engine RPM | 5500 RPM | 4000 RPM |
Engine Bore Size | 65 mm | 68 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 67.7 mm | 78 mm |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Drive Type | Front | Rear |
Transmission Type | Manual | Manual |
Vehicle Weight | 695 kg | 785 kg |
Vehicle Length | 3420 mm | 4120 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1500 mm | 1510 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1430 mm | 1560 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2170 mm | 2460 mm |
